Establishment of Statutory Measure: Registration of Producers and Exporters of Table Grapes
Ministry of Agriculture, Ministry of Forestry,Ministry of Fisheries, South Africa
The statutory measure sets out to enforce registration of specified parties with the South African Table Grape Industry (SATI), which is tasked with implementing the measure. Parties shall have the option to register as either a producer or an exporter, or both; for parties that both produce and export. The measure hopes to create a level playing field for players and stakeholders by ensuring access to accurate and timely information to guide their decision process. The measure applies to table grapes intended for export.

Land Survey Act
Ministry of Rural Development and Land Reform, South Africa
The Survey Act sets out to regulate the survey of land in the Republic of South Africa. It gives powers to the minister to appoint a land surveyor as the Surveyor-General of the Republic, as well as Surveyor-General for each province or group of provinces. The powers of the appointees and their duties and responsibilities are detailed in the act.

Regulations Relating to the Further Conservation and Protection of Seals
Ministry of Agriculture, Ministry of Forestry,Ministry of Fisheries, South Africa
The notice stipulates that; no person shall, at any place in South Africa not part of areas specified in section 3 of the sea birds and seals protection act of 1973, knowingly pursue, shoot, disturb, kill, or capture any seal except under an exemption or permit granted by the relevant authorities.

National Environmental Management Act
Ministry of Environmental Affairs and Tourism, South Africa
The Act recognizes the right of citizens to environments that are beneficial to health and well-being; and the right to have the environment protected, for the benefit of present and future generations. through reasonable legislative and other measures that prevent pollution, environmental degradation, and promotes the sustainable development and use of natural resources. The Act develops a framework for integrating good environmental management into all development activities, establishing principles guiding the exercise of functions related to the environment, and establishing procedures promoting public participation in environmental governance.

Regulations Relating to Foodstuffs for Infants, Young Children, and Children
Ministry of Health, South Africa
The regulations place restrictions on the sale of food that does not meet the standards or requirements defined. It stipulates that certain nutritional and other information must be written on labels attached to foodstuffs. The regulations apply to infants under the age of 12 months and for children up to 12 years of age.

Sectional Titles Schemes Management Act
Ministry of Rural Development and Land Reform, South Africa
The Act provides for the establishment of bodies corporate, to manage and regulate sections and common property in sectional titles schemes; and to establish a sectional titles schemes management advisory council. Bodies corporate is defined in relation to a building and the land in a sectional title scheme to mean the body corporate of that building; while a building is defined as a structure of a permanent nature erected or to be erected and which is shown on a sectional plan as part of a scheme.

Regulations Governing the Maximum Limits for Pesticide Residues that may be Present in Foodstuffs
Ministry of Health, South Africa
These Regulations prohibit the importation, sale or manufacture of foodstuffs containing residues of defined chemical substances in excess of prescribed maximum limits. A sampling of pesticide residues in food shall be carried out in accordance with the latest edition of the Codex Alimentarius Standards.

Roadmap for Nutrition in South Africa (2013-2017)
Ministry of Health, South Africa
The government acknowledges the position of sound nutrition as a basic human right and prerequisite for attaining full intellectual and physical potential. Nutrition is seen as the outcome of a developmental process and not services to be delivered. The roadmap highlights the manifestations of malnutrition prevalent in South Africa and possible underlying conditions. The five-year roadmap seeks to direct nutrition-related activities in the health sector to the achievement of the sector’s four focus areas: life expectancy; maternal and child mortality; HIV and AIDS and tuberculosis; and strengthened health systems.

Regulations Regarding Control of the Export of Processed Products
Ministry of Agriculture, Ministry of Forestry,Ministry of Fisheries, South Africa
It is stated that “no person shall export processed products from the Republic of South Africa unless quantities have been approved by the executive officer for that purpose”. It details application for approval of export, inspection guidelines and procedure, assessment of competence of testing laboratories involved in inspection, necessary fees, approvals and rejections, as well as an appeal process.

Norms and Standards for the Inclusion of Private Nature Reserves in the Register of Protected Areas of South Africa
Ministry of Environmental Affairs and Tourism, South Africa
The norms and standards apply to lands regarded as nature reserves, and private lands declared as nature reserves. The guiding principles for the norms and standards include; preserving the ecological integrity of protected areas, preserving the nation’s biodiversity, protecting South Africa’s threatened species, providing for the sustainable use of natural and biological resources, and managing the relationship between environmental biodiversity, human settlement, and economic development.

Merchant Shipping (INF Code) Regulations
South Africa, South African Maritime Safety Authority
The regulations give effect to the section on the carriage of dangerous goods of the safety convention. The regulations apply to every South African ship carrying irradiated nuclear fuel (INF) cargo; they do not apply to ships owned or operated by the government of another state.

Merchant Shipping (Safe Containers Convention) Act
Ministry of Tourism, South Africa
The Act gives effect to the international convention for safe containers. The act binds the state and every organ of the state. It extends transport to the Prince Edward Islands. It declares contracting states, makes provisions of the convention have a force of law, specifies appointment of inspectors, and powers and functions.
